The 1/16 final match of the tough tournament of the WTA 1000 series held in Indian Wells (USA) on March 12 was between Jessica Pegula (USA, WTA 3) and Russia. Anastasia Potapova (WTA 28).

The match ended in Pegula’s favor with a score of 3:6, 6:4, 7:5 in three sets.

Potapova entered the match wearing a T-shirt from Moscow football club Spartak.

Polish journalist Adam Romer asked a rhetorical question on his Twitter account:

“Here is the first case to be considered in terms of being accepted or not at Wimbledon. Is this a reason to exclude Potapova or not yet?

According to British media, if the ban for tennis players from the Russian Federation and the Republic of Belarus at Wimbledon this year is lifted, they may be asked to sign the Code of Conduct before the tournament starts. The details of the rules are unknown, but it is unlikely that there will be a clause stating that athletes will be allowed to openly show any support for Russia …
